Insgesamt10000 bezogener Inhalt gefunden
Einbeziehung von URL -Fragmenten in Laravels Pagination
Artikeleinführung:Das Paging -System von Laravel enth?lt eine leistungsstarke Fragment () -Methode, mit der Sie URL -Fragmente an Paging -Links anbringen k?nnen. Diese Funktion ist besonders nützlich, wenn Sie Benutzer w?hrend der Navigation zu bestimmten Teilen der Seite anweisen.
Die Fragment () -Methode integriert sich nahtlos in das Paginationssystem von Laravel:
$ user = user :: paginate (15)-> fragment ('user');
Nach dem Rendering enthalten diese Paging -Links #User automatisch in ihre URL, wodurch die Benutzer zum entsprechenden Teil der Seite geleitet werden.
Die Fragment () -Methode wird insbesondere beim Umgang mit mehreren Inhaltsteilen oder komplexen Navigationsstrukturen zutreffend
2025-03-05
Kommentar 0
616
Wie rufe ich API-Antworten mit cURL und PHP ab: Eine Schritt-für-Schritt-Anleitung?
Artikeleinführung:Dieser Artikel stellt einen Codeausschnitt für eine PHP-Klasse bereit, die cURL zum Abrufen von API-Antworten verwendet. Das Snippet definiert eine Funktion zum Abrufen der API-Antwort, zum Verarbeiten von Weiterleitungen, zum Festlegen des Benutzeragenten und zum Verwalten von Zeitüberschreitungen, was es zu einem nützlichen Werkzeug für die Interaktion macht
2024-10-26
Kommentar 0
1100
Wie rufe ich API-Antworten mit cURL in PHP ab?
Artikeleinführung:In diesem Artikel wird eine PHP-Klasse (ApiCaller) vorgestellt, die das Erhalten von Antworten von einer API mithilfe von cURL erleichtert. Die Klasse bietet eine standardisierte und wiederverwendbare Methode zum Ausführen von HTTP-GET-Anfragen und zur Verarbeitung von Optionen wie Headern, automatischer Umleitung,
2024-10-24
Kommentar 0
1025
Wie füge ich mit SimpleXmlElement CDATA-Abschnitte zu XML-Dateien hinzu?
Artikeleinführung:Dieser Artikel stellt eine benutzerdefinierte PHP-Klasse, SimpleXMLExtended, bereit, die die SimpleXMLElement-Klasse erweitert, um CDATA-Abschnitte zu XML-Dateien hinzuzufügen. Es enth?lt ein konkretes Beispiel für die Verwendung dieser Klasse zum Einfügen von CDATA in ein XML-Dokument und zur Behebung des Problems
2024-10-23
Kommentar 0
1044
Wie kann ich mit cURL effektiv API-Antworten in PHP abrufen?
Artikeleinführung:In diesem Artikel wird eine eigenst?ndige PHP-Klasse für die Arbeit mit APIs unter Verwendung der cURL-Bibliothek vorgestellt. Es bietet eine Methode zum Ausführen von API-Aufrufen und zum Erfassen von Antworten als JSON, was Entwicklern die Integration mit externen Diensten erleichtert. Der Code
2024-10-24
Kommentar 0
1201
Schneller Tipp: Wie man mit Ausnahmen in PHP umgeht
Artikeleinführung:Key Takeaways
Die Exception -Klasse von PHP bietet Methoden zum Erhalten von Informationen zu Ausnahmen wie der Datei- und Zeilennummer, in der sie aufgetreten sind, und eine Nachricht, die den Fehler beschreibt. Wenn eine Ausnahme nicht erwischt wird, wird sie durch den Standard behandelt
2025-02-08
Kommentar 0
888
Wie erstelle ich CDATA-Abschnitte in XML mit SimpleXmlElement?
Artikeleinführung:Dieser Artikel demonstriert eine Technik zum Einbinden von CDATA-Abschnitten (Character Data) in XML-Dokumente mithilfe der SimpleXmlElement-Klasse von PHP. Die CDATA-Abschnitte erm?glichen die Einbindung von ungeparstem Text in die XML-Struktur. Das bereitgestellte Beispiel umfasst
2024-10-23
Kommentar 0
979
Was ist die Vererbung in der programmorientierten PHP-objektorientierten Programmierung?
Artikeleinführung:Die Vererbung in der programmorientierten pHP-objektorientierten Programmierung bedeutet, dass eine Klasse (Unterklasse) die Eigenschaften und Methoden einer anderen Klasse (übergeordnete Klasse) erben kann, um die Wiederverwendung von Code und die klarere Struktur zu implementieren. 1. Erstellen Sie Unterklassen mit Extends Keyword. 2. Unterklassen k?nnen übergeordnete Klassenmethoden aufrufen und ihr Verhalten durch Umschreiben ?ndern. 3.. Anwendbar auf "IS-A" -Bewegs, um eine tiefe Vererbungshierarchie und eine enge Kopplung zu vermeiden. Zum Beispiel erbt die Hundeteilsklasse die Tierklasse und überschreibt die Speak () -Methode, mit der sowohl Code als auch anpassen k?nnen.
2025-06-22
Kommentar 0
879
Problemloser Dateisystemoperationen w?hrend des Tests? Ja, bitte!
Artikeleinführung:Virtual Dateisystem (VFS) simuliert Dateisystemvorg?nge in Unit -Tests und vermeidet das Problem der Reinigung tempor?rer Dateien. In diesem Artikel wird beschrieben, wie die VFSStream -Bibliothek verwendet wird, um die Prüfung von Dateisystemvorg?ngen in PHP -Unit -Tests zu vereinfachen.
Erstens haben wir eine einfache Filecreator -Klasse zum Erstellen von Dateien:
2025-02-14
Kommentar 0
506
Selbstbeobachtung und Reflexion in PHP
Artikeleinführung:Kernpunkte
Mit dem Introspection -Mechanismus von PHP k?nnen Programmierer Objektklassen manipulieren und Klassen, Schnittstellen, Eigenschaften und Methoden überprüfen. Dies ist besonders nützlich, wenn die zum Zeitpunkt des Designs ausführende Klasse oder Methode unbekannt ist.
PHP bietet verschiedene introspektive Funktionen wie class_exists (), get_class (), get_parent_class () und is_subclass_of (). Diese Funktionen liefern grundlegende Informationen zu Klassen wie ihren Namen, den Namen der übergeordneten Klassen usw.
Die Reflexions-API von PHP liefert introspektativartige Funktionen und bereitet die Anzahl der Klassen und Methoden, die zur Erfüllung von Reflexionsaufgaben verwendet werden, reicher. Die ReflectionClass -Klasse ist eine API
2025-02-27
Kommentar 0
282
PHP -?nderungsdatumformat in der Zeichenfolge
Artikeleinführung:Es gibt zwei gemeinsame Methoden zum Konvertieren von Datumsformaten in PHP: Eine besteht darin, Strtotime () mit der Funktion Date () zu verwenden, wie z. Das andere ist die empfohlene DateTime-Klasse, die mehr Formate unterstützt und zuverl?ssiger ist, z. Darüber hinaus müssen Zeitzonenprobleme über DATE_DEFAULT_TIMEZONE_SET () eingestellt werden, w?hrend lokalisierte Anzeigen für intDateForma verwendet werden k?nnen
2025-07-06
Kommentar 0
370
So verwenden Sie PHP für Redis
Artikeleinführung:Frage: Wie verwendet ich Redis in PHP? Installieren Sie die Redis -PHP -Erweiterung. Stellen Sie eine Verbindung zum Redis -Server her und verwenden Sie die Redis -Klasse. Daten speichern und abrufen und Zeichenfolgen, Hashs, Listen und Sammlungen unterstützen. Verwenden Sie andere Befehle wie die überprüfung auf Schlüsselvorlagen, L?schen von Schlüssel und Festlegen der Ablaufzeit von Schlüssel. Schlie?en Sie die Verbindung nach der Verwendung von Redis.
2025-04-10
Kommentar 0
808
Verwenden von Merkmalen in PHP 5.4
Artikeleinführung:Anleitung zur Verwendung von Merkmalen in PHP 5.4
Kernpunkte
Der in PHP 5.4 eingeführte Merkmalsmechanismus erm?glicht die horizontale Wiederverwendung von Code zwischen unabh?ngigen Klassen der Vererbungshierarchie, die L?sung der Grenzen der einzelnen Vererbung und zur Reduzierung der Code -Duplikation.
Eine einzelne Klasse kann mehrere Merkmale verwenden, und Merkmale k?nnen auch aus anderen Merkmalen bestehen, wodurch eine flexible und modulare Methode zur Organisation von Code erm?glicht wird.
Verwenden Sie stattdessen Schlüsselwort, um Konflikte zwischen Merkmalen mit demselben Methodennamen zu beheben, oder verwenden Sie das Keyword zum Erstellen von Methoden -Alias.
Merkmale k?nnen auf private Eigenschaften oder Methoden einer kombinierten Klasse zugreifen und umgekehrt und sogar umgehen
2025-02-28
Kommentar 0
508
Verst?ndnis der prototypischen Vererbung von JavaScript im Vergleich zu klassischen Modellen
Artikeleinführung:Der Vererbungsmechanismus von JavaScript basiert eher auf einer Prototypkette als auf einer Klasse. Jedes Objekt hat [[Prototyp]], das auf seinen Prototyp hinweist, und die Attributsuche verfolgt entlang der Prototypkette nach oben. 1. Die Essenz des Prototyps: Das Objekt ist durch [[Prototyp]] mit anderen Objekten verbunden, um eine Kette zum Auffinden von Eigenschaften zu bilden; 2. Klassenvergleich: Die Klasse von ES6 ist syntaktischer Zucker, und die zugrunde liegende Schicht wird immer noch vom Prototyp implementiert. 3. Hinweise: Vermeiden Sie die Teilen von Referenztypen am Prototyp, steuern Sie die L?nge der Prototypkette, um die Leistung zu optimieren, und die Konstruktorparameter müssen manuell verarbeitet werden. V. Die beiden k?nnen gemischt werden, aber die Prinzipien müssen verstanden werden. Wenn John.greet () beispielsweise aufgerufen wird, wird die Methode in PERSO definiert
2025-07-15
Kommentar 0
585